Информация
Услуги
  • Внедрение
  • Настройка
  • Поддержка
  • Ремонт
Контакты
Оплата
Новости
Доставка
Загрузки
Форум
Настройка
    info@proxmox.su
    +7 (495) 320-70-49
    Заказать звонок
    Аспро: ЛайтШоп
    Войти
    0 Сравнение
    0 Избранное
    0 Корзина
    Аспро: ЛайтШоп
    Войти
    0 Сравнение
    0 Избранное
    0 Корзина
    Аспро: ЛайтШоп
    Телефоны
    +7 (495) 320-70-49
    Заказать звонок
    0
    0
    0
    Аспро: ЛайтШоп
    • +7 (495) 320-70-49
      • Назад
      • Телефоны
      • +7 (495) 320-70-49
      • Заказать звонок
    • info@proxmox.su
    • Москва, Бакунинская улица, 69с1
    • Пн-Пт: 09-00 до 18-00
      Сб-Вс: выходной
    • 0 Сравнение
    • 0 Избранное
    • 0 Корзина
    Главная
    Форум
    Proxmox Виртуальная Среда
    Добавьте учётную запись пользователя/группы с доступом по SSH и правами root.

    Форумы: Proxmox Виртуальная Среда, Proxmox Backup Server, Proxmox Mail Gateway, Proxmox Datacenter Manager
    Поиск  Пользователи  Правила  Войти
    Страницы: 1
    RSS
    Добавьте учётную запись пользователя/группы с доступом по SSH и правами root., Proxmox Виртуальная Среда
     
    Gonzalo
    Guest
    #1
    0
    26.07.2016 11:49:00
    Следуя инструкциям https://pve.proxmox.com/wiki/User_Management#Linux_PAM_standard_authentication и https://pve.proxmox.com/wiki/User_Management#Administrator_Group, я могу создать пользователя с полными правами администратора через веб-интерфейс. Однако, когда я подключаюсь по SSH к узлам кластера, я не могу выполнять команды вроде "qm" для разблокировки ВМ. Мне нужно, чтобы пользователи из группы администраторов могли выполнять эти "команды суперпользователя" без предоставления им учетных данных пользователя root. Большое спасибо. Гонсало.
     
     
     
    AlexanderMomchilov
    Guest
    #2
    0
    25.02.2024 17:07:00
    Если тебе нужны root-команды, скорее всего, захочешь установить `sudo` (`apt install sudo -y`) и добавить своего пользователя в группу `sudo`. В root-сессии: Bash: usermod -aG sudo Alex

    # Чтобы отменить это:
    # deluser Alex sudo. Не забудь перезайти в систему под своим пользователем, чтобы изменения вступили в силу. Можешь проверить так: Bash: $ id
    # uid=1000(Alex) gid=1000(Alex) groups=1000(Alex),27(sudo),1001(admin)
    #                                                 ^^^^^^^^ Это работает, потому что `%sudo   ALL=(ALL:ALL) ALL` уже есть в `/etc/sudoers`, но изменения не применяются к текущей сессии. Многие программы, специфичные для Proxmox, находятся в `/usr/sbin`, поэтому добавь это в свой PATH: Bash: # В свой ~/.zshrc, или аналогичный

    export PATH="/usr/sbin:$PATH"
     
     
     
    LnxBil
    Guest
    #3
    0
    26.02.2024 22:20:00
    Помни, что с sudo у тебя не будет нормальной автоподстановки в шелле для команд pve. Это будет работать только для root:

    Код: test@proxmox-test:~$: sudo qm list <tab> -bash: compgen: предупреждение: опция -C может работать не так, как ты ожидаешь

    ipcc_send_rec[1] failed: Unknown error -1
    ipcc_send_rec[2] failed: Unknown error -1
    ipcc_send_rec[3] failed: Unknown error -1
    Unable to load access control list: Unknown error -1

    -bash: compgen: предупреждение: опция -C может работать не так, как ты ожидаешь

    ipcc_send_rec[1] failed: Unknown error -1
    ipcc_send_rec[2] failed: Unknown error -1
    ipcc_send_rec[3] failed: Unknown error -1
    Unable to load access control list: Unknown error -1
     
     
     
    AlexanderMomchilov
    Guest
    #4
    0
    14.03.2024 01:54:00
    Интересно. Есть ли какой-то способ это исправить?
     
     
     
    LnxBil
    Guest
    #5
    0
    16.03.2024 12:53:00
    Помимо очевидного: sudo использовать не стоит, ни в коем случае. Ещё можно попробовать ограничить использование оболочки и всё делать через API/GUI от имени непривилегированного пользователя. qm и pct подойдут в односерверной системе, но в кластерной среде они абсолютно бесполезны. Там нужен хороший pve cli клиент.
     
     
     
    AlexanderMomchilov
    Guest
    #6
    0
    17.03.2024 18:59:00
    Ну что ж, спасибо, что упомянули это ограничение. Большинству пользователей, наверное, проще просто использовать стандартного пользователя `root`. Может, я просто слишком придираюсь, подражая догме "не используй root" ха-ха.
     
     
     
    Страницы: 1
    Читают тему
    +7 (495) 320-70-49
    info@proxmox.su

    Конфиденциальность Оферта
    © 2026 Proxmox.su
    Главная Каталог 0 Корзина 0 Избранные Кабинет 0 Сравнение Акции Контакты Услуги Бренды Отзывы Компания Лицензии Документы Реквизиты Поиск Блог Обзоры